AGARTALA, Nov 12 (TIWN): CM Biplab Deb's visit programmes are being massively boycotted by own party MLAs created turmoil in the party. It is happening followed by massive rebellion among the majority of the BJP MLAs against CM Biplab Deb about whom maximum MLAs have already complained to the Centre. During his Karbook visit, the local MLA there Burbo Mohan Tripura was not present with him which erupted questions. Moreover, in the Salema Block under Dhalai District, 2 MLAs have boycotted the CM's meeting which was called to review the developmental works on 7th November. The two MLAs have been identified as 1) Parimal Debbarma, 2) Asish Das. In various programmes in same way, anti-Biplab Deb trend has hit the party. Massive rebellions are going on inside the Tripura BJP Party which include former Party Presidents, MLAs, Ministers.
Complaint against CM Biplab Deb's dictator style and various corruptions were sent to Delhi also. Along with CM Biplab Deb, Minister Ratanlal Nath is also sharing the massive resentment reason among the MLAs.
Minister Ratanlal Nath has allegedly mistreated MLA Parimal Debbarma over phone which has generated resentments inside the party.
As per reports, over an unapproved transfer list of teachers, MLA Parimal Debbarma had called Minister Ratanlal Nath but Nath allegedly misbehaved with MLA Parimal Debbarma.
MLA Parimal Debbarma himself has alleged about it, expressing resentments over the attitude of the Minister.
However, MLA Parimal Debbarma said that to strengthen the party and to keep the party's unity, he had taken the initiative to call the Minister. He said, for party and Govt's welfare he had to receive such treatments and in future also for good works he is ready to except such abuses.
With all these, over 27 MLAs directly, indirectly had expressed resentments over Biplab Deb and Ratanlal Nath, seeking Biplab Deb's immediate removal from power. The MLAs also have set a plan to move 'No Trust Motion' in the Assembly.
